David Tremlett, a major figure in British abstraction, is a British painter and sculptor. He has held numerous solo exhibitions around the world and produced monumental "Wall Drawings". He rejects the classical hierarchy between the arts, which presupposes a separation between painting, sculpture and architecture. In his practice, Tremlett has developed an entirely personal conception of wall drawing. Manual execution gives his creations a powerful sensory dimension. These works modify space and establish a veritable poetics of place, gesture and time, seeking to transmit their memory. His strong, sensitive art is nourished by his many travels and his interest in architecture.
